C-PAP at a Glance
C-PAP, also called CPAP, stands for continuous positive airway pressure. It is a sleep therapy that delivers a gentle, constant flow of air through a mask, tubing, and a small bedside machine. The air pressure helps prevent the upper airway from narrowing or closing while a person sleeps.
CPAP is most often prescribed for obstructive sleep apnea (OSA), a condition in which throat muscles relax during sleep and repeatedly block airflow. These pauses may lead to snoring, gasping, fragmented sleep, low oxygen levels, and daytime fatigue. CPAP is not a sedative, oxygen treatment, or ventilator for most users; the person continues to breathe independently, while the device supports an open airway.
For many people with moderate to severe OSA, CPAP is considered a first-line treatment because it works when it is worn properly and regularly. Its benefits depend not only on the prescribed settings, but also on a comfortable mask, good sleep habits, follow-up care, and consistent use throughout sleep.
How C-PAP Works and What It Can Improve

During sleep, the tissues at the back of the throat can relax, especially when a person lies on their back. In obstructive sleep apnea, this may partly or completely block the airway. CPAP creates a small column of air that acts like an internal support, helping keep the airway open during both inhalation and exhalation.
When treatment is effective, it can reduce breathing interruptions, loud snoring, choking sensations, and repeated awakenings. Many people notice better sleep continuity and improved daytime concentration or energy. Some improvements are apparent within days, while others develop over several weeks as sleep becomes more restorative.
CPAP may also help reduce the strain that untreated OSA can place on the cardiovascular system. However, it should be viewed as one part of a personalized health plan rather than a replacement for medical care, physical activity, weight management where appropriate, or treatment for related conditions such as high blood pressure.
- Fixed-pressure CPAP: delivers one prescribed pressure throughout the night.
- Auto-adjusting PAP (APAP): varies pressure within a clinician-set range in response to breathing patterns.
- Bilevel PAP (BiPAP): uses different pressures for breathing in and out and may be considered in selected situations.
Who May Need C-PAP?

A clinician may recommend CPAP after testing confirms obstructive sleep apnea. A sleep study may be performed overnight in a sleep laboratory or, for appropriate patients, with a home sleep apnea test. The decision considers the number and type of breathing events, oxygen changes, symptoms, medical history, and individual preferences.
Common symptoms that can prompt assessment include frequent loud snoring, witnessed pauses in breathing, waking with gasping or choking, morning headaches, dry mouth, unrefreshing sleep, and excessive daytime sleepiness. Not everyone who snores has sleep apnea, and some people with OSA do not realize that their sleep is disrupted.
Risk factors for OSA include excess body weight, a larger neck circumference, nasal blockage, alcohol use near bedtime, smoking, family history, and anatomical differences involving the jaw, tongue, or throat. OSA can affect people of different body types and ages. It may also occur alongside conditions such as high blood pressure, heart disease, type 2 diabetes, or stroke.
Central sleep apnea is different from OSA because it involves reduced breathing effort from the brain’s breathing control centers rather than physical airway blockage. It requires careful medical evaluation, and the most suitable positive airway pressure approach may differ. A sleep specialist can determine whether CPAP is appropriate for a person’s specific diagnosis.
Starting Treatment: Equipment, Setup, and Adjustment
A standard CPAP system includes a machine, flexible tubing, a mask, and a power supply. Masks come in several styles: nasal masks cover the nose, nasal pillows rest at the nostrils, and full-face masks cover the nose and mouth. The best choice depends on facial shape, sleeping position, comfort, nasal breathing, and whether a person tends to breathe through the mouth at night.
Pressure settings should be prescribed or reviewed by a qualified clinician. Modern devices often record information such as hours of use, mask leak, and residual breathing events. This data can help a care team identify practical barriers and decide whether adjustments are needed. People should not independently change prescribed settings unless instructed by their treating team.
It is normal to need an adjustment period. Wearing the mask for a short time while awake, such as while reading or watching television, can help a person become familiar with the sensation. Some devices have a ramp feature that starts at a lower pressure and gradually rises after bedtime. Heated humidification may reduce dryness or nasal irritation for some users.

Common C-PAP Challenges and Practical Solutions
Initial discomfort does not mean CPAP will not work. The most frequent concerns are a mask that feels tight, air leaking around the seal, nasal stuffiness, dry mouth, skin irritation, or difficulty falling asleep with the equipment. These problems are usually manageable with assessment and small adjustments rather than stopping treatment.
A mask should be secure but not overly tight. Excessive tightening can worsen leaks and leave pressure marks. A clinician or equipment provider can check mask size and style, adjust headgear, or suggest a mask liner. If air escapes from the mouth while using a nasal mask, the care team may discuss strategies such as treating nasal congestion, trying a chin strap, or changing mask type.
Dry nose or throat may improve with heated humidification, adequate fluid intake during the day, and attention to room air dryness. Nasal saline products may help some people, but persistent congestion should be discussed with a clinician, particularly before using medicated nasal sprays. Claustrophobia or anxiety can often improve through gradual daytime practice and supportive coaching.
Regular cleaning helps maintain comfort and function. The mask cushion should be cleaned according to manufacturer instructions, and the water chamber should use the recommended water type and be emptied regularly. Filters, tubing, and mask components need replacement on the schedule advised by the manufacturer or care provider. Avoid unapproved cleaning methods that could damage equipment or leave irritating residues.
Supporting C-PAP With Sleep and Lifestyle Care
CPAP treats the airway obstruction while the device is being used, but it does not permanently cure OSA. Stopping treatment can allow breathing interruptions to return. Using CPAP for the entire time spent asleep, including naps, gives the best opportunity for consistent symptom control.
Healthy sleep habits can support treatment. A regular sleep schedule, a quiet and comfortable bedroom, and limiting alcohol close to bedtime may reduce sleep disruption. Alcohol and sedating medicines can relax upper-airway muscles or alter breathing; people should ask their clinician or pharmacist about medicines that may affect sleep apnea, rather than stopping prescribed medication on their own.
For people with excess weight, gradual, sustainable weight management may lessen OSA severity and improve overall health. Exercise, balanced nutrition, smoking cessation, and treatment of nasal allergies or reflux can also be useful for some individuals. Even if symptoms improve after lifestyle changes, a clinician should confirm whether CPAP settings or ongoing treatment need to be changed.
Travel is usually possible with CPAP. It is helpful to carry the machine in hand luggage, bring the power supply and mask, and plan for electrical adapters when needed. People should check airline and destination requirements in advance, especially if they may need to use the device during a flight or in areas with limited electricity.
When to Seek Medical Care
Anyone with loud habitual snoring, observed breathing pauses, repeated nighttime choking, or significant daytime sleepiness should arrange a medical assessment. This is especially important when sleepiness affects driving, work, concentration, or safety. A clinician can identify whether sleep apnea or another sleep, heart, lung, or neurological condition may be contributing.
People already using CPAP should contact their care team if they remain very sleepy despite regular use, wake feeling short of breath, have persistent headaches, experience painful skin injury from the mask, or cannot tolerate the therapy. Downloaded device information and a review of mask fit, sleep duration, medications, and underlying conditions can help identify the cause.
Urgent medical advice is appropriate for severe or worsening shortness of breath, chest pain, fainting, blue or gray lips, or confusion. These symptoms are not expected effects of routine CPAP use and need prompt clinical evaluation. A person should also seek advice before using CPAP if they have had recent facial surgery or trauma, certain ear or sinus problems, or a new serious respiratory illness.
Frequently asked questions
What is the difference between C-PAP and CPAP?
There is no practical difference. C-PAP and CPAP are both used to describe continuous positive airway pressure therapy. CPAP is the more common clinical abbreviation.
Does C-PAP provide oxygen?
Standard CPAP uses room air that is pressurized to keep the airway open; it does not routinely add oxygen. Some people have separate oxygen needs due to lung or heart conditions, and this must be assessed and prescribed by a clinician.
How long does it take to get used to C-PAP?
Adjustment varies from person to person. Some people adapt within a few nights, while others need several weeks of mask fitting, humidification changes, or gradual practice. Ongoing difficulty should be discussed with the sleep care team rather than simply discontinuing therapy.
Can a person use C-PAP if they have a cold or blocked nose?
Many people can continue treatment during a mild cold, particularly with humidification and advice about managing nasal symptoms. However, severe congestion, significant sinus or ear pain, or a respiratory infection may make use difficult. A healthcare professional can provide individualized guidance.
Is C-PAP treatment lifelong?
CPAP is commonly needed for as long as obstructive sleep apnea remains present. Weight changes, upper-airway surgery, oral appliance treatment, or changes in health can affect the condition, but treatment should only be reduced or stopped after reassessment by a qualified clinician.
What should a person do if their C-PAP mask leaks?
First, the person should check that the mask is clean, correctly assembled, and fitted without excessive tightening. Changing sleep position, replacing worn cushions, or trying a different mask style may help. Persistent leaks should be reviewed by the equipment provider or sleep clinic because they can reduce comfort and treatment effectiveness.
